  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the PA Form 93 in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the name of the deceased in the designated field under 'IN RE: ESTATE OF'. Ensure accuracy as this is crucial for record-keeping.
  3. Fill in the case number and date of death in the respective fields. This information helps identify the specific estate involved.
  4. In the 'CLAIM' section, input your name as the claimant and provide a detailed description of your claim against the estate, including the amount owed.
  5. Complete the address fields accurately to ensure proper communication regarding your claim.
  6. If applicable, include details about any personal representative or counsel who has been notified about this claim.
  7. Review all entries for accuracy before saving or printing your completed form using our platform’s features.

Form REV-516 Notice of Transfer(Stocks,Bonds, Securities or Security Accounts held in Beneficiary Form) to request Waiver Notice of Transfer, must be completed and submitted to the department for investment accounts titled in a transfer on death (TOD), payable on death (POD) or any designated beneficiary

Claiming Tax Forgiveness To claim tax forgiveness, the claimant or claimants must complete and submit PA-40 Schedule SP with the PA-40, Individual Income Tax return. On PA-40 Schedule SP, the claimant or claimants must: Determine the amount of Pennsylvania-taxable income.
